#455 - DBS Not Allowed to Make New Acquisitions & Watch Taylor Swift Concert With a Minister?
As part of the penalties for the recent outage of DBS’ digital services, MAS will disallow DBS from making new acquisitions for 6 months. Will this really help restore confidence in the bank? Elsewhere, it was first reported that a lucky Swiftie between the age of 13-35 will be selected to watch Taylor Swift in concert alongside Senior Minister of State Mr Tan Kiat How, as part of a youth festival competition. However, the promotion was hastily amended on Friday morning to remove the minister’s presence at the concert. #449 - Will Grab, Trans-cab Merger Lessen Competition? & Foodpanda CEO Replaced After Allegedly Leaking Confidential Information of Grab Sale
This past week, Singapore’s competition watchdog pumped the brakes on the Grab-Trans-cab merger, voicing concerns over how Trans-cab taxi drivers’ usage of other ride-hailing platforms would be affected. Would this merger really lessen competition in the industry? Elsewhere, the Foodpanda CEO was shown the door after allegations of leaking confidential information on a potential sale of the company to Grab. #448 - DBS Services Down in Major Disruption & Flash Coffee Abruptly Quits Singapore
Over the weekend, retailers and consumers had their plans disrupted by a major outage of DBS’ banking services, which was allegedly caused by an issue at a data centre. Why did one bank’s outage have such a big ripple effect on Singapore? This same week, Flash Coffee suddenly shut down all 11 local outlets, leaving its workers with unpaid salaries and CPF. #447 - Singapore’s “Remarkable” Religious Diversity & NParks Puts Down Giant Crocodile
A US think tank’s analysis of a 2022 survey hailed Singapore’s high levels of interreligious tolerance and acceptance. Why are these results worth celebrating for Singaporeans? Elsewhere, out of safety concerns, NParks captured and put down a nearly-3m long crocodile that had been spotted on Marina East beach. Some groups asked why the crocodile had to be put down, and not relocated instead.
